Abstract: The present paper reports results regarding the development and validation of the Strategy Inventory for Electronic Dictionary Use (S. I. E. D. U.), which is a reliable 5-Likert scale self-report instrument consisting of 59 Questions for assessing users' skills and strategies in online electronic dictionary searches. Following Gavriilidou's (2013) Strategy Inventory for Dictionary Use (S.I.D.U.) structure for assessing dictionary use strategies, the S.I.E.D.U includes five subscales: a. Dictionary use awareness skills, b. Dictionary selection strategies, c. Strategies for lemmatization and acquaintance with dictionary conventions, d. Navigation skills and e. Look-up strategies in the new electronic environments. The method of multiple judges was adopted for the control of content validity of the pilot version of S.I.E.D.U. The Cronbach Alpha coefficient was employed in order to provide a measure of the reliability of S.I.E.D.U. Internal consistency of the five subscales and the overall scale of the S.I.E.D.U. ranged from good to excellent.
